From a Distant Past is a re-working of “Morning Afternoon Evening,” created for 2023/24. This performance piece consists of recorded text from Kyra Jucoyv’s poem, spoken by actor Tzena Nicole over background music, dance, and projected imagery. In this intimate iteration, including 5 dancers, the viewers are the protagonist, given a voice by the words of the actor and a body through the movement of the dancers, who also portray her companions. The work, which depicts a journey following a river, has rich and varied dynamics and includes beautiful and eerie depictions of nature through words, movement, costumes, and imagery. It encompasses timeless and timely themes of destruction leading to creation, darkness to light, endings to beginnings. Included in is Isadora Duncan repertory in Grecian tunics, which adds to the mythic overtones expressed through movement, tableaux, and lighting. These overtones reinforce the theme of cycles: of individuals, humanity, eras, universes-from the eternal past, and perhaps on into the eternal future. This timeless work continuously seems to transform in meaning as times change and as the world takes on new challenges.
